I've had a Supersprint race system for a couple of years and my car has been given some stick. Personally I've had no problems and never had issue with the welds or the cats and am glad I have this system over a Miltek but that's purely personal preference.
Didn't the Milteks have problems with rattly cats at some point? Supersprints might have a a weld finish problem but I'd not actually heard that and like I say I've not experienced said problem.
For me the Supersprint sounds awesome, but the race system is pretty loud and can give you problems getting on track so be aware.
